Epilepsy Awareness

Purple Day

March 26, 2019

Purple Day was started in 2008 by a young girl, Cassidy Megan, who wanted to have a special day dedicated to epilepsy awareness.  Now in it's 10th year, it is recognized and honored in over 75 countries around the world.
